Bangla, Panna

Bangla is a village located in the Devendranagar Tehsil of Panna district of Madhya Pradesh. The village falls in Panna block and comes under Bhataharmegha Gram Panchayat. It belongs to Khajuraho parliament constituency and Gunnaor assembly constituency.

As on April 2024, the current population of Bangla is 471 out of which 250 are males and rest 221 are females. The sex ratio of this village is 884 females per 1000 males. There are around 39 teenagers in Bangla. It has literacy rate of 73% which means around 343 persons can read and write. Total 7 people belonging to scheduled caste and 0 scheduled tribe people live in the village. There are around 104 households in Bangla, which means every family has 5 members on average. The village has working population of 207. The pincode of Bangla is 488333 and there are many postoffices around the village which can used to send speed post, registered parcel etc.
